Luke 23

34 Ref And Jesus said, Father, let them have forgiveness, for they have no knowledge of what they are doing. And they made division of his clothing among them by the decision of chance.

35 Ref And the people were looking on. And the rulers made sport of him, saying, He was a saviour of others; let him do something for himself, if he is the Christ, the man of God's selection.

36 Ref And the men of the army made sport of him, coming to him and giving him bitter wine,

37 And saying, If you are the King of the Jews, get yourself free.

38 Ref And these words were put in writing over him, THIS IS THE KING OF THE JEWS.

39 Ref And one of the evil-doers on the cross, with bitter feeling, said to him, Are you not the Christ? Get yourself and us out of this.
